Does Parenting Have To Be So High Stakes? | Lane Shackleton (father of 3, CPO at Coda)

May 23, 2024
59:10

Lane Shackleton is the Chief Product Officer of Coda, where he has worked for over 8 years. Prior to that he had a 9+ year career at Google and Youtube as a product manager and leader. He’s a loving husband and the father of three kids. In today's conversation we discussed:

* How to motivate and teach lessons to your kids through “quests”

* Lowering the pressure on high-stakes parenting

* Two actions that can solve most of the challenges you’ll experience with your kids

* The difference in feeling overwhelmed between a parent and a professional

* Why parenting overwhelm can be so much harder to work through

* Leveraging technology as a builder vs. a passive consumer

* Balancing being a startup executive with coaching a baseball team full of 9 year olds — and which one is harder
